Description

Opening Midsummer Night, Shake on the Exe return. In the near future, step into a world where nature has reclaimed the city in A Midsummer Night?s Dream like you?ve never seen before. In this bold reimagining, towering skyscrapers crumble beneath tangled vines, and neon lights flicker through the mist of an urban jungle. Love, magic, and mischief unfold as lost lovers make their escape from the chains of tradition, mischievous fairies threaten to tear the very fabric of existence apart with their lovers' war, and hapless actors navigate the wild heart of a city transformed. With stunning visuals, contemporary music, and Shakespeare?s timeless wit, this production breathes new life into a classic tale of enchantment and chaos. Enter the dream?where the streets are alive, the forest never sleeps, and anything is possible.

Description

The Cygnet Theatre in Exeter stands as a significant cultural asset, an educational charity dedicated to the rigorous training of actors for over four decades. Beyond its foundational role in nurturing emerging talent, it functions as a vibrant hub for both professional and community-led artistic endeavours, contributing substantially to the region's performing arts landscape.

Within its walls, the intimate 100-seat auditorium offers a distinct atmosphere. The air often carries the faint, comforting scent of aged timber and theatrical greasepaint, while the well-trodden floorboards resonate with the echoes of countless rehearsals and performances. This flexible space, originally a parish hall dating back to 1914, retains a sense of history and purpose.

Practical considerations are well-addressed, ensuring broad access for all patrons. The venue provides ramp access and facilities for wheelchair users, including accessible toilets, and welcomes guide dogs. A bar is available for refreshments, and performers benefit from dedicated dressing rooms with shower facilities and a shared kitchen.

Throughout the year, the Cygnet presents a diverse programme encompassing classical and contemporary drama, musical theatre, and new writing. It regularly hosts musical events, dance, comedy, and folk performances, alongside its own company's productions and those of visiting troupes, offering a consistent stream of engaging live experiences.
